188-1930-5727

首页新闻资讯经验分享

外贸网站优化JavaScript加载?延迟执行技巧2025

技术部黄智
营销网站建设 中小企业建网站 发表时间:2025-10-26 23:20:13 阅读量:0
导读 Guide

随着全球化的推进,外贸电商行业在2025年迎来了新的挑战与机遇。外贸网站的竞争愈加激烈,如何提升网站的加载速度,特别是JavaScript的加载,已成为每个外贸网站优化者关注的重点。良好的网站性能不仅能提升用户体验,还能增强seo排名,从而提高转化率。因此,掌握JavaScript延迟执行的技巧,优化外贸网站的加载速度,是网站优化过程中不可忽视的一环。

为什么JavaScript加载速度如此重要?

JavaScript是现代网站中不可或缺的一部分,几乎所有动态交互、数据处理、页面动画都离不开它。但是,JavaScript的加载可能成为外贸网站性能瓶颈。特别是当JavaScript文件过大,或者多个JavaScript文件被同时加载时,会显著增加页面加载的时间,影响用户访问的流畅度,进而影响seo和转化率。

根据Google的研究,页面加载时间每延迟1秒,用户的跳出率就会增加7%。因此,优化JavaScript的加载速度,对于提升外贸网站的用户留存、提高网站搜索引擎排名、提升转化率都有至关重要的作用。

什么是JavaScript延迟执行?

JavaScript延迟执行(LazyLoading)是一种常见的前端优化技术,通过推迟加载某些JavaScript脚本,避免在页面初次加载时阻塞渲染。简而言之,延迟执行的核心理念就是“按需加载”,即在用户访问网站时,只有当特定功能或元素需要时,才加载相关的JavaScript代码。

这种技术的最大优势在于减少了首次加载时的资源消耗,使得网站页面能够更快速地展示给用户。尤其是在外贸网站中,用户群体广泛且多样,加载速度的优化直接决定了用户体验和seo表现。

如何实施JavaScript延迟执行?

使用async和defer属性:现代浏览器支持通过async和defer属性来优化JavaScript文件的加载顺序和时机。async表示脚本会异步加载,但会立即执行,可能会阻塞后续的DOM渲染;而defer属性会让JavaScript文件在HTML解析完成后再执行,从而避免阻塞页面渲染。通过合理使用这两个属性,外贸网站可以减少JavaScript对页面加载的影响。

按需加载第三方库:对于外贸网站来说,很多JavaScript库和插件都是依赖第三方资源(如地图、支付系统等)。而这些第三方库可能并不是在每个页面上都需要。通过按需加载技术,可以确保只有在用户访问相关功能页面时,才会加载这些库,从而提升网站的整体加载速度。

动态加载关键JavaScript功能:对于那些非关键性的JavaScript功能,可以考虑使用动态加载的方式。比如在页面首次加载时,只加载最基本的交互功能,其他复杂的功能可以等到用户需要时再加载。例如,可以使用IntersectionObserverAPI来监听用户是否滚动到某个元素,只有当元素进入视口时,才加载相关的JavaScript脚本。

减少JavaScript的文件大小:优化JavaScript文件本身的体积,使用工具如Webpack、Rollup、Terser等进行代码压缩和优化,去除不必要的代码和注释,减少文件大小。这样,不仅能减少网络请求的时间,也能提高脚本加载和执行的速度。

将JavaScript文件合并:将多个JavaScript文件合并成一个文件,可以减少HTTP请求的次数,避免浏览器频繁请求不同的脚本文件。但这种做法需要谨慎,过度合并可能导致一个巨大的文件,加载速度反而更慢。因此,合理分配合并的程度和时机是非常重要的。

延迟执行对seo的影响

在外贸网站seo优化中,页面加载速度已经成为排名算法中的重要因素。Google等搜索引擎倾向于优先展示那些加载速度较快的页面,而速度慢的页面往往会被降权,排名靠后。通过延迟加载JavaScript文件,可以有效减少页面的首次加载时间,从而提升seo表现。

JavaScript延迟执行技术还能帮助提高网站的“核心WebVitals”得分。核心WebVitals是Google针对页面加载性能的评估指标,包括最大内容绘制(LCP)、首次输入延迟(FID)和累计布局偏移(CLS)。延迟执行JavaScript能够改善这些核心指标,从而提高页面的综合性能。

如何测试延迟执行效果?

在实施JavaScript延迟执行之后,网站管理员可以通过多个工具来测试优化效果。Google的PageSpeedInsights工具是其中最常见的一个,它能够帮助分析页面的加载速度并提供改进建议。Lighthouse和WebPageTest也是非常有用的工具,可以进行深入的性能分析,找出JavaScript文件加载对网站性能的具体影响。

延迟执行的最佳实践

合理设置延迟时间:延迟执行并不是一刀切的解决方案。对于不同的功能和页面,延迟加载的时间应该有所不同。对于一些重要的功能,如购物车、产品详情等,可能需要立即加载并提供互动;而对于辅助功能(如社交分享按钮、广告等),可以设置较长的延迟时间。

使用懒加载库:开发者可以利用一些现成的懒加载库(如Lazysizes、Lozad.js等)来简化JavaScript延迟加载的实现。这些库通常提供了很好的API接口,可以快速地集成到网站中,节省了开发者的时间和精力。

监控用户行为:为了优化延迟执行的时机,外贸网站可以通过监控用户的行为来判断何时加载JavaScript。例如,利用scroll、click、hover等事件监听用户的行为,来触发JavaScript的加载,确保不会影响用户的操作体验。

优化JavaScript加载顺序:在执行JavaScript延迟加载时,确保关键的脚本和资源在页面加载时优先加载。通过合理的资源分配,确保页面的核心功能能在用户访问时最快速度地启动。

渐进式增强:延迟执行技术应该与渐进式增强(ProgressiveEnhancement)相结合。也就是说,应该首先确保网站的基本功能和内容可以在没有JavaScript的情况下正常显示,只有在支持JavaScript的环境下,才加载更多的互动和动态功能。

总结

随着2025年外贸网站竞争的日益激烈,优化网站的JavaScript加载速度变得越来越重要。通过实施延迟执行技术,外贸网站可以有效减少页面加载的时间,提升用户体验,同时还可以改善seo表现和转化率。希望通过本文所述的延迟加载技巧,能够帮助站长们在激烈的竞争中脱颖而出,赢得更多的国际客户。

在未来,随着技术的不断进步,JavaScript加载优化将变得更加智能化和自动化。外贸网站应不断关注最新的优化方法,保持竞争优势,为全球用户提供更流畅、更高效的浏览体验。


如没特殊注明,文章均为高端网站定制专家万智网络原创,转载请注明来自https://www.wanzhiweb.com/xwzx/jyfx/9447.html

上一篇 外贸网站代码压缩工具有哪些?效果对比
下一篇 外贸网站优化遭遇负面SEO?反制措施2025